Nicholas Hytner

Nicholas Hytner (born May 7, 1956) is an award-winning British theatrical and opera producer and director. Born in Manchester, he has directed such plays as Ghetto, Miss Saigon, Orpheus Descending and Carousel. He was appointed director of the Royal National Theatre in London in 2003. He has also directed movies such as The Crucible and Center Stage.
